For those of you who can't wait for the official Firefly soundtrack, the soundtrack for the original (unaired) version of Serenity was largely borrowed from the soundtrack for the David Lynch movie "The Straight Story" by Angelo Badalamenti. Its available on CD and is really worth it. It's a little different in tone than the stuff done for the series, but overall the music for the series follows this style pretty closely.

On a side note, the movie "The Straight Story" is wonderful as well. Very atypical for Lynch, given that it is a G-rated Disney production and does, in fact give you basically a 'straight story' about an old man traveling across Iowa on a tractor to visit his brother. Incredible performance by Richard Farnsworth. Anyway, see if you can find the soundtrack at the very least.
